Output 85578cf7b81f126ada9df0c713f0eaf7e16c0dbc8a917d04cc26899d827bd40c:0

value
35216853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89b20aca8eba8f3c0957d05084b58dc90166f6db OP_EQUAL
address
3EF5nQkB3xW7WU2ftu8f4xMx5kvGPEEce9
transaction
85578cf7b81f126ada9df0c713f0eaf7e16c0dbc8a917d04cc26899d827bd40c
spent
true